The cheapest way to get from Vasai to Vapi is to train which costs ₹160 - ₹1,300 and takes 2h 39m.
The fastest way to get from Vasai to Vapi is to drive which takes 1h 54m and costs ₹1,400 - ₹2,100.
No, there is no direct train from Vasai to Vapi. However, there are services departing from Vasai Road and arriving at Vapi via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 39m.
The distance between Vasai and Vapi is 133 km. The road distance is 129.2 km.
The best way to get from Vasai to Vapi without a car is to train which takes 2h 39m and costs ₹160 - ₹1,300.
It takes approximately 2h 39m to get from Vasai to Vapi, including transfers.
Vasai to Vapi train services, operated by Indian Railways, depart from Vasai Road station.
Vasai to Vapi train services, operated by Indian Railways, arrive at Vapi station.
Yes, the driving distance between Vasai to Vapi is 129 km. It takes approximately 1h 54m to drive from Vasai to Vapi.
